Climate action

We believe that for business growth to be truly sustainable, we must accelerate the transition to a low carbon future and reduce the impact of climate change by reaching real net zero. We are proud to be one of the first companies in the world to have our net zero target validated under the new SBTi Net-Zero Standard.  

In 2022, we extended this commitment to include Japan and are in the process of setting a new Dentsu Groupwide SBTi-approved Net-Zero target.

Our net zero target is aligned with limiting global temperature rise to 1.5°C to prevent the worst impacts of climate change. It includes two targets. A near-term target to reduce absolute emissions by 46.2% by 2030 across Scope 1, 2 and 3 (from a 2019 base year) and a long-term deep decarbonization target to reduce absolute emissions across our entire value chain by 90% by 2040. Our focus is on carbon reduction and once we’ve achieved the 90% reduction, we will neutralize any residual emissions by investing in nature-based solutions. ​  

In 2022, we made strong progress in our decarbonization efforts, reducing our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 52.8% against our 2019 baseline, and by 33.5% compared to 2021*. This far exceeds the 12.6% reduction target we had planned to meet in 2022. With good progress on our operational footprint, we now increase our focus on Scope 3, which includes our supply chain and the products and services we bring to market.

*Japan uses a financial control approach. For owned buildings, all equity usage is recorded, including tenant usage. Dentsu will agree a consistent organizational boundary approach as part of the integration program.

Decarbonizing media since 2019

The global scale of our industry is not to be underestimated. How we produce and disseminate our campaigns and work with our clients, partners and suppliers has an impact, and will play a critical role in the journey to net-zero for the industry. Businesses like ours can play a significant part, and we can all work together to decarbonize faster.

At dentsu, we have set a target to reduce the emissions associated with our media supply chain by 46% by 2030 (from a 2019 baseline). Achieving this will require collaboration across the entire media ecosystem, including our clients, many of whom have set their own science-based targets.

Nature-based solutions

We cannot solve the climate emergency without nature as our ally. In 2021, dentsu became signatories to the WWF Business for Nature’s Call to Action asking governments to adopt ambitious nature policies.  

In 2022 we took our first steps, compensating for our remaining Scope 1 and 2 emissions for our international business (excluding Japan) through investment in nature-based projects. 

Through this work we invested in forest conservation initiatives in Zimbabwe and local renewable energy projects in India and Brazil. Aside from positive environmental impacts, these projects also support local communities and sustainable development in the areas.   

Moving forward, we will place nature at the heart of our net-zero commitment, driving projects that balance climate action with our commitment to biodiversity.

Advocating for change 

A shift to a sustainable, net zero world is a journey for our clients and society, with no single solution, so engaging with a wide a range of stakeholders to advocate for change is a critical enabler of our social impact strategy.   

We collaborate with international stakeholders relevant to our industry, clients and the communities in which we work. We share insights and experiences, collaborate on industry initiatives to drive ambition, and engage with clients and policy makers on multi-lateral platforms that engage policy and government in the issues that core to our strategy and society’s transition to a net zero world.   

As an organization with the potential to influence consumer and societal behaviour and action, we have a responsibility to engage proactively with clients and stakeholders to advocate for change and ambition. Examples include:   

UN Global Compact: We are members of this long standing voluntary business initiative based to take strategic action to support the UN Sustainable Development Goals.  

World Business Council for Sustainable Development:  

Dentsu is a member of WBCSD, a global, CEO-led organization of over 200 leading businesses working together to accelerate the transition to a sustainable world.  

World Economic Forum  

The World Economic Forum's Alliance of climate leaders is a coalition of CEO's from around the world and from across industry sectors committed to delivering concrete climate solutions and innovations in their practices, operations and policies.  

Cambridge Institute of Sustainability Leadership – Business Transformation Group 

Dentsu is the only sector member of this innovative group of leading businesses for sustainability who develop new thinking and solutions to share with businesses to support the transformation journey towards a sustainable economy. 

Ad Net Zero  

We are a member of the Ad Net Zero steering group helping to reduce the carbon impact of the UK advertising industry to real net zero.  

Business for Nature 

Business for Nature is a global coalition bringing together influential organizations and forward-thinking businesses. Together, we demonstrate business action and call for ambitious and collective action on nature. 

Responsible Media Forum 

We are founding members of the Responsible Media Forum, a partnership between 25 leading media companies to further how the industry’s unique influence can benefit society as well as shareholders.   

Sustainable Brands 

We are members of Sustainable Brands, a global community of brand innovators who are helping to share the future of commerce worldwide.  

Global Alliance of Responsible Media 

Dentsu is a strategic partner and Chair of GARM, a global collaboration of agencies, media platforms and industry associations to rapidly improve digital safety and drive accountability across the industry.
